Good news for the Pack!

Now that Greg Jennings has gotten a new contract, perhaps the Packers can focus on a new deal for Pro Bowl FS Nick Collins.  Collins showed up for the mandatory minicamp, but clearly is not excited about the $3 million he’ll be making this year.  Now, if my boss came to me and said I had such a great year that I’m going to get a 600% raise over last year, I’d being doing backflips down the hallway.  Unfortunately, in the wide world of sports, that’s just not enough money.

I’ll grant you that a Pro Bowl free safety is worth more — we’re talking professional football players reality now, not the rality most of us live in — than $3M a year.  So, I can see why he’d like to have an extension done.  But, look at what Jennings did to get his.  He showed up and worked his arse off doing what he said he’d do when he signed his contract.  Thompson rewarded his good little soldier with a deal that is front loaded with guaranteed millions.  Other people who were unhappy with their contracts or other things in the organization and complained publicly (Brett Favre, Javon Walker, Mike McKenzie, Corey Williams, Ryan Grant, etc.) are either not there, or they came up short of what they were looking for.  People who showed up and did their jobs (Aaron Rodgers, Greg Jennings, Aaron Kampman, etc) all got their extensions for the money they wanted (granted we’ll see if Kampman gets a second extension or not).

I sure hope Nick is taking notes.
